Notes about Evert Jansen

Kinderen:
1. Willem Jansen, geboren in 02-1889 in Putten. Willem is overleden op 31-03-1889 in Putten, 1 maand oud.
2. Willempje Jansen, geboren in 1891 in Putten. Beroep: Dienstbode. Willempje trouwde, 18 jaar oud, op 19-02-1909 in Putten [bron: Huwelijksakte nr. 5] met Willem Grift, 23 jaar oud. Willem is geboren in 1886 in Putten, zoon van Willem Grift en Teuntje Knevel. Beroep: Arbeider.
3. Aartje Jansen, geboren in 1893 in Putten. Aartje trouwde, 19 jaar oud, op 29-11-1912 in Putten [bron: Huwelijksakte nr. 41] met Marinus van de Brug, 25 jaar oud. Marinus is geboren in 1887 in Putten, zoon van Jan van de Brug en Besseltje Teunissen. Beroep: Arbeider.
4. Willem Jansen, geboren op 22-01-1895 in Putten. Beroep: Arbeider. Willem trouwde, 23 jaar oud, op 05-04-1918 in Putten [bron: Huwelijksakte nr. 11] met Jannetje Willemsen, 16 jaar oud. Jannetje is geboren in 1902 in Putten, dochter van Willem Willemsen en Willemtje Mosterd.
5. Metje Jansen, geboren op 24-10-1899 in Putten. Metje trouwde, 18 jaar oud, op 13-09-1918 in Putten [bron: Huwelijksakte nr. 30] met Hendrik van Boeschoten, 24 jaar oud. Hendrik is geboren in 1894 in Putten, zoon van Jannes van Boeschoten en Gerritje Ruiter. Beroep: Arbeider.
6. Steventje Jansen, geboren in 1902 in Putten. Steventje trouwde, 18 jaar oud, op 24-09-1920 in Putten [bron: Huwelijksakte nr. 66] met Willem Koetsier, 29 jaar oud. Willem is geboren in 1891 in Putten, zoon van Jan Koetsier en Gijsje Elberta Gerritsen. Beroep: Arbeider.

Z.v. Willem Jansen en Willempje Frederiksen.
